Delaware Teen Shot Dead In Chester

MyFoxPhilly - Fri Nov 20

A 19-year-old man was shot and killed in Chester City late Thursday night. Police said Kaliym Bowman was shot several times in the 1300 block of Crosby Street at 11:18 p.m.. He was rushed to Crozer-Chester Medical where he was pronounced dead at 11:35 p.m. Police said Bowman was a New Castle County, Del., resident.

Jobless Rate at Record High

1450 WILM NEWSRADIO - Fri Nov 20

Unemployment in Delaware reached 8.7% in October. The State Department of Labor says that's the highest figure since it began to track joblessness, and is up .4% from September.
